[Ktutorial-commits] SF.net SVN: ktutorial:[202] trunk/ktutorial/ktutorial-editor
Status: Alpha
Brought to you by:
danxuliu
|
From: <dan...@us...> - 2010-03-28 00:50:59
|
Revision: 202
http://ktutorial.svn.sourceforge.net/ktutorial/?rev=202&view=rev
Author: danxuliu
Date: 2010-03-28 00:50:53 +0000 (Sun, 28 Mar 2010)
Log Message:
-----------
Ooops, add files missed in commit 201
Added Paths:
-----------
trunk/ktutorial/ktutorial-editor/src/data/CMakeLists.txt
trunk/ktutorial/ktutorial-editor/tests/unit/data/CMakeLists.txt
Added: trunk/ktutorial/ktutorial-editor/src/data/CMakeLists.txt
===================================================================
--- trunk/ktutorial/ktutorial-editor/src/data/CMakeLists.txt (rev 0)
+++ trunk/ktutorial/ktutorial-editor/src/data/CMakeLists.txt 2010-03-28 00:50:53 UTC (rev 202)
@@ -0,0 +1,12 @@
+set(ktutorial_editor_data_SRCS
+ Reaction.cpp
+ Step.cpp
+ Tutorial.cpp
+ WaitFor.cpp
+ WaitForComposed.cpp
+ WaitForEvent.cpp
+ WaitForNot.cpp
+ WaitForSignal.cpp
+)
+
+kde4_add_library(ktutorial_editor_data ${ktutorial_editor_data_SRCS})
Property changes on: trunk/ktutorial/ktutorial-editor/src/data/CMakeLists.txt
___________________________________________________________________
Added: svn:eol-style
+ native
Added: trunk/ktutorial/ktutorial-editor/tests/unit/data/CMakeLists.txt
===================================================================
--- trunk/ktutorial/ktutorial-editor/tests/unit/data/CMakeLists.txt (rev 0)
+++ trunk/ktutorial/ktutorial-editor/tests/unit/data/CMakeLists.txt 2010-03-28 00:50:53 UTC (rev 202)
@@ -0,0 +1,40 @@
+# Used by kde4_add_unit_test to set the full path to test executables
+set(EXECUTABLE_OUTPUT_PATH ${CMAKE_CURRENT_BINARY_DIR})
+
+include_directories(${ktutorial-editor_SOURCE_DIR}/src/data ${KDE4_INCLUDES})
+
+MACRO(UNIT_TESTS)
+ FOREACH(_className ${ARGN})
+ set(_testName ${_className}Test)
+ kde4_add_unit_test(${_testName} TESTNAME ktutorial-editor-unit-${_testName} ${_testName}.cpp)
+ target_link_libraries(${_testName} ktutorial_editor_data ${QT_QTTEST_LIBRARY})
+ ENDFOREACH(_className)
+ENDMACRO(UNIT_TESTS)
+
+unit_tests(
+ Reaction
+ Step
+ Tutorial
+ WaitFor
+ WaitForComposed
+ WaitForEvent
+ WaitForNot
+ WaitForSignal
+)
+
+MACRO(MEM_TESTS)
+ FOREACH(_testname ${ARGN})
+ add_test(ktutorial-editor-unit-mem-${_testname} ${CMAKE_CURRENT_SOURCE_DIR}/runMemcheck.py ${CMAKE_CURRENT_BINARY_DIR}/${_testname}Test ${CMAKE_CURRENT_BINARY_DIR})
+ ENDFOREACH(_testname)
+ENDMACRO(MEM_TESTS)
+
+mem_tests(
+ Reaction
+ Step
+ Tutorial
+ WaitFor
+ WaitForComposed
+ WaitForEvent
+ WaitForNot
+ WaitForSignal
+)
Property changes on: trunk/ktutorial/ktutorial-editor/tests/unit/data/CMakeLists.txt
___________________________________________________________________
Added: svn:eol-style
+ native
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
|